TICKET-4417: DeployBeacon bot vault locked

The DeployBeacon chat bot can't read deploy-status tokens since the Korrin vault auto-sealed after three failed auth attempts overnight. Bot replies "status unavailable" in every channel. Review scope: the unseal hook in beacon-core/vault.go plus the retry cap change in PR 882. Nothing else touches the seal path. To unseal the Korrin vault and restore the bot, use the recovery passphrase below.

unlock words, yawig-kagef: gordor-holvan-ulaael-pramir-ulaiel-tamdor

// Bloom filter sizing for the Kestrelstore front cache.
// False-positive target is 0.5% at 80M keys; if misses spike,
// check filter saturation before blaming the KV tier.
// Do NOT shrink BLOOM_BITS under load — rebuilds block writes
// for ~40s. Resize only during the Oakham maintenance window.
// The filter build that shipped with this constant is traced
// by the token on the next line.

pipeline stamp: htk9_ce63042d9

## Releases

Graphwick, our dependency graph visualizer, ships a tagged release every two weeks from the `stable` branch. The release job renders the frontend bundle, builds the CLI for three platforms, and signs every artifact before upload. As a contractor you won't cut releases yourself, but you will need to verify downloads when testing against production builds. Verification uses `gw-verify` with the team's published signing key. To save you a lookup, the current release signing key is included here.

rollout seal: bky4_yke3